Pay Range: $100,800 - $165,600 Position Summary: The Senior Manufacturing Engineer is responsible for planning, designing, and maintaining manufacturing processes across Filling, Kitting, Packaging, and Shipping. Ensures systems run to specifications and comply with regulations while supporting cross-functional teams to optimize materials, labor, equipment, and systems. Key Responsibilities: Maintain a strong presence in manufacturing and operational areas, working directly with frontline employees and leaders to observe work, understanding process challenges, and identify waste, bottlenecks, workload imbalance, waiting, unnecessary movement, rework, and ineffective handoffs. Investigate & identify operational inefficiencies and productivity improvements within manufacturing and operational areas. Use time studies, standard-labor analysis, line balancing, workload and capacity analysis, process mapping, and material-flow assessments to understand current performance and identify improvement opportunities. Define and execute automation strategy and roadmap, aligning with business objectives for cost, quality, throughput, and scalability. Manage automation projects through planning, design, architecture, building, and deployment following company procedures. Incorporate advanced automation systems; including but not limited to robotics, vision systems, PLCs, and collaborative robots (COBOTs), across manufacturing operations. Drive end-to-end process optimization initiatives, leveraging Lean Six Sigma, data analytics, and digital manufacturing tools to deliver sustained KPI improvements (OTD, cycle time, yield, and labor efficiency). Own capital automation projects from concept through commissioning, including business case development, equipment specification, vendor selection, FAT/SAT, and full lifecycle validation (IQ/OQ/PQ). Lead cross-functional initiatives with Quality, Operations, Supply Chain, and R&D to industrialize new products and scale manufacturing processes. Establish and standardize engineering best practices, including automation standards, validation protocols, and documentation systems. Champion digital transformation initiatives, including integration of MES, data systems, and smart factory technologies.
